Modern engineering trends heavily focus on expanding volumetric structural footprints post-transport. Expandable container units deploy via telescoping slide-outs or hydraulic folding configurations, expanding usable workspace by up to 200% from transit profiles.
Today's base camps incorporate off-grid capabilities. Photovoltaic solar array integration, high-density battery storage packages, and customized greywater filtration loops reduce operating expenditures and structural environmental footprint in remote deployment sectors.
With shifting geopolitical climates and severe weather events, global design parameters mandate higher seismic ratings, extreme wind load certifications (up to Category 5 hurricanes), and premium non-combustible sandwich insulation systems.
Traditional fixed modular systems impose high mobilization/demobilization costs. By adopting foldable and expandable structural engineering, enterprise procurement divisions can reduce transit footprints by up to 75% while maintaining massive square-footage capacities upon destination arrival.

Extractive industries require temporary housing that satisfies strict local occupational health regulations. High-density, acoustic-insulated structural systems with custom sanitary and recreational configurations ensure labor force retention and compliance with local standards.
Time-to-site represents the primary KPI in emergency relief scenarios. Flat-pack and expandable camps enable immediate mobilization via global sea/air routes, deploying operational medical clinics, command post modules, and temporary shelters within hours.
High-end modular architecture is expanding into eco-resorts and hotel extensions. Demands prioritize aesthetic custom interior finishes, premium glazing, expansive balconies, and seamless integration with localized municipal utilities.

Tailored structural optimization based on geographic and atmospheric deployment profiles.
Thermal Control: Heavy insulation configurations using polyurethane (PU) core sandwich panels. Double-pane low-E glass options with integrated reflective coatings mitigate extreme thermal transmission, reducing HVAC electricity draw by up to 40%.
Structural Loading: Engineered roof profiles capable of handling heavy structural snow loads. Internal hydronic floor heating system integrations, specialized sealing membranes, and heavy rockwool thermal barrier cores prevent internal moisture condensation.
Corrosion Mitigation: Standard Q235B/Q345B steel structural frameworks receive multi-layer anti-corrosive powder coatings. External fasteners, hinges, and corner castings are optimized with marine-grade stainless steel to resist salt fog environments.
